## Runbook: Per-Tenant Rate Quotas

Scope: Throttleworks enforces per-tenant quotas at the edge. Quotas live in the Meterbox API; edge nodes cache them for 60s.

If a tenant reports spurious 429s: check Meterbox for a stale quota record, then flush the edge cache. Do not raise quotas manually without a change record. All quota reads and writes require auth against Meterbox, using the key below.

API key for yahig-tadup: kto7_ubizbYm

## FeedCheck validator — plugin runbook

Plugins submit candidate podcast feeds to the CastProof validation queue. Queue accepts RSS and the Lanterbury JSON variant only. On 429, back off 60s; no exceptions. Validation results land on your registered callback within five minutes — longer means the queue is draining, check the status page first. Do not retry a feed marked malformed; fix and resubmit as new. All queue calls authenticate against the internal CastProof gateway using the key below.

gateway credential: kto3_qfe

Compaction on Quibblemq kicks in once a partition hits the segment cap, so don't panic if old entries vanish — that's the point. Plugin authors hooking into the compaction callbacks need broker credentials in their local .env before the hooks will fire at all. Drop the line below into your environment file before testing.

secret setting of hawep-yahig: LEDGER_TOKEN29=41b5d6315371c92885eaeb077fb63

Grandfathered rates end for all accounts signed before the platform migration. Talking points ship Monday; do not pre-announce. Exceptions require director approval and a retention justification. Expect churn in the small-account tier; retention offers are capped at 4% discount for two-year commitments. Track objections in the standard tracker so we can adjust messaging mid-quarter. The rationale behind this timing is summarized in the confidential note below.

board note of kafog-bajep: Briathek Partners is in early talks to buy Aldaelek Group for about $47.1 million. The Ulaath launch date is September 4, and nothing goes to the press before then.